## Reseller Programme — Managers Only

The Veltrix reseller programme launches Q3. Tier structure: Bronze, Silver, Gold, with margin bands rising accordingly. Korvane Trading and Pellam Systems are confirmed anchor partners. Onboarding runs through the Ashdown office; certification mandatory before first order. No exceptions on credit terms. Board approval required for any Gold-tier discount above standard. The strategic rationale is summarised in the note below.

board note of bajop-yaweg: The western region missed its Pelys quota by 58.0 percent last quarter. Pelysek Foods plans to raise the Belius list price by 44.0 percent in July. The steering committee signed off on a budget of $133.8 million for Project Pelax. The renewal with Zoraelix Systems closes at $61.9 million a year, 12.7 percent above the last contract.

Handover — Bramble KV bloom filter. The filter sits in front of the Dunmore key-value store and absorbs roughly 90% of lookups for absent keys. Watch the false-positive rate metric; above 2% it means the filter needs a rebuild, which the nightly job normally handles. The rebuild job reads from the sealed snapshot bucket, so if you trigger it manually you will need the recovery passphrase below.

strongbox words: sormir-sorael-rusax

## Test data

Use Fabrikker for all fixtures. Do not hand-roll records; factories enforce referential integrity that raw inserts skip. Each factory lives beside its model under `factories/`. Override only the fields your test asserts on — defaults are randomized per run to catch hidden coupling. Sequences reset between suites, never within one. Traits compose left to right. The full trait catalog and override rules are documented internally here.

operations page: https://jenkins.zemvarcloud.local/job/merge_requests/repo/build/73930b4b30f0a8ed